After judging more than 150 submissions across 12 categories, judges have announced the finalists for the 2019 Moreton Bay Business Excellence & Innovation Awards.
Finalists will now have their fingers crossed that they have done enough to win their respective category, share in $30,000 in cash prizes, and possibly take out the top award, the Moreton Bay Regional Council Business of the Year.
Winners will be announced at the Gala Event hosted at Eatons Hill Hotel on 29 November. Congratulations to the 2019 nominees and finalists.

Moreton Bay Regional Council Business of the Year will be announced at the Gala Awards ceremony.
The 2019 awards program is proudly delivered by Moreton Bay Region Industry & Tourism (MBRIT) in partnership with Moreton Bay Regional Council.
MBRIT Chairman, Shane Newcombe, says the awards are not just for the winners, but for all businesses, nominees, and finalists.
“The thriving business community we have in the Moreton Bay Region doesn’t just happen. It’s through the hard-work and dedication of local operators and their staff, community groups, entrepreneurs, and young people,” Mr Newcombe said.
“The business awards are a chance for groups and individuals, along with their friends and family, to recognise and celebrate all their efforts from the past year.”
Moreton Bay Regional Council Mayor Allan Sutherland congratulated the success of local businesses in the region in 2019.
“The strength of this year’s impressive applications reflects the innovation and quality our local businesses are always striving for,” Mayor Sutherland said
“Local businesses are incredibly valuable to our regional economy and Council is proud to support these awards as a way to celebrate and recognise the outstanding professionalism of our local business sector.
“Moreton Bay Region is one of the fastest growing economies in Queensland - last financial year we had nearly 3000 new businesses registrations and our economy grew to more than $18.5 billion.
“That success is owed entirely to the energy and talent of local business owners and the employees that power them.”
Finalists from 12 award categories will be notified on Monday, 21 October with winners presented at the gala event. Judges will also present the major award, Moreton Bay Regional Council Business of the Year, to one of the 2019 applicants.
